![]() I hope you got in your rest during winter and the holiday season because this is the time of year to come out and play and there is no rest for the weary as back-to-back festivals and cultural events carry us through to Semana Santa. Here's a quick summary of what's to come in the next few weeks,we'll be covering some of these in more detail soon. FILM - Jan. 28 - Final film in Chaplin series at Teatro Variedades_, EL GRAN DICTADOR (The Great Dictator) 1940. THEATER - The English-speaking Little Theatre Group will kick off the 2013 season with a Cabaret Night, theater and musical performances will be the highlight of this Jam at the Bar. 7:30 on Feb. 8, 2.500 entrance fee at Sala Garbo. ROCK - Festival del Rock en el Farolito, 11a - 8p Feb. 16 and 17. This is a free concert featuring prominent Costa Rican rock bands in Parque Morazan. Full line-up schedules will appear on the facebook page. ELECTRONIC - ChepeJoven is an annual event that opens up international electronic music for free to Costa Ricans while closing Paseo Colon for a Sun. As the name implies, this will be an event mostly attended by teenagers and then electronic fans of all ages. Hosted also on Feb. 17 you can listen to music ALL DAY downtown. This festival runs 8a - 3p. DJs spinning include: - Jeff Brenes - Monik Zdan - Hector Moran (El Salvador) - Erik Prestinary - ¿? - Lawrence Casal - Huba&Silica INNOVATION - TEDxPuraVida is an independently organized event with the same spirit of 'ideas worth sharing'. Presentations are in Spanish but that's a good opportunity to practice and a great chance to meet some of the nation's thought leaders. Tickets are $150, the event will be hosted at the Children's Museum. A full schedule of presenters is available. ![]() Downtown Yoga is a special place situated in the heart of San Jose, 1/2 block west of the SW corner of Parque Nacional. Open for 2 years, the studio aims to make yoga more accessible to the people living and working in and around San Jose, Costa Rica. Future plans include providing yoga in the low-income neighborhoods of the city and implementing a community garden with bicycle parking. The primary group of students are Costa Rican but because the management and teachers speak English, and there are classes everyday it's a great stop for travelers looking to relax as they wonder around the country. The best part is that visitors can feel right at home immediately being introduced to fellow students and teachers. To read more about the studio visit its Yoga in English page. Drop-in classes are $10, call 6050-1952 to reserve your space.
![]() For all of you who have never heard of the Oscar nominee films and want to catch up before those shiny statues are awarded in March, you can preview the majority of the Best Picture selections and a few others throughout Feb. at the Cine Magaly, located in Barrio La California. These will also be the first films shown in digital format at the theater so prep those eyeballs for clear images. This theater is a beautiful example of an art deco interior, however much of it has been toned down after the renovation and reopening a year ago. Tickets are 2.300 general admission, 1.800 students and senior gold card holders. A 12 film pass is 20.000. Movie times are below.
